• Skip to content
  • Skip to link menu
KDE API Reference
  • KDE API Reference
  • kdelibs API Reference
  • KDE Home
  • Contact Us
 

KUtils

Classes | Protected Types | Protected Member Functions | Protected Attributes | List of all members
KCMultiDialogPrivate Class Reference

#include <kcmultidialog_p.h>

Inheritance diagram for KCMultiDialogPrivate:
Inheritance graph
[legend]

Classes

struct  CreatedModule
 

Protected Types

typedef QList< CreatedModule > ModuleList
 

Protected Member Functions

 KCMultiDialogPrivate ()
 
virtual void _k_clientChanged ()
 
void _k_dialogClosed ()
 
void _k_slotCurrentPageChanged (KPageWidgetItem *current, KPageWidgetItem *previous)
 
void _k_updateHeader (bool use, const QString &message)
 

Protected Attributes

KCModuleProxy * currentModule
 
ModuleList modules
 

Detailed Description

Definition at line 31 of file kcmultidialog_p.h.

Member Typedef Documentation

typedef QList<CreatedModule> KCMultiDialogPrivate::ModuleList
protected

Definition at line 49 of file kcmultidialog_p.h.

Constructor & Destructor Documentation

KCMultiDialogPrivate::KCMultiDialogPrivate ( )
inlineprotected

Definition at line 35 of file kcmultidialog_p.h.

Member Function Documentation

void KCMultiDialogPrivate::_k_clientChanged ( )
protectedvirtual

Reimplemented in KSettings::DialogPrivate.

Definition at line 108 of file kcmultidialog.cpp.

void KCMultiDialogPrivate::_k_dialogClosed ( )
protected

If we don't delete them, the DBUS registration stays, and trying to load the KCMs in other situations will lead to "module already loaded in Foo," while to the user doesn't appear so(the dialog is hidden)

Definition at line 191 of file kcmultidialog.cpp.

void KCMultiDialogPrivate::_k_slotCurrentPageChanged ( KPageWidgetItem *  current,
KPageWidgetItem *  previous 
)
protected

Definition at line 83 of file kcmultidialog.cpp.

void KCMultiDialogPrivate::_k_updateHeader ( bool  use,
const QString &  message 
)
protected

Definition at line 175 of file kcmultidialog.cpp.

Member Data Documentation

KCModuleProxy* KCMultiDialogPrivate::currentModule
protected

Definition at line 40 of file kcmultidialog_p.h.

ModuleList KCMultiDialogPrivate::modules
protected

Definition at line 50 of file kcmultidialog_p.h.


The documentation for this class was generated from the following files:
  • kcmultidialog_p.h
  • kcmultidialog.cpp
This file is part of the KDE documentation.
Documentation copyright © 1996-2014 The KDE developers.
Generated on Tue Oct 14 2014 22:50:35 by doxygen 1.8.7 written by Dimitri van Heesch, © 1997-2006

KDE's Doxygen guidelines are available online.

KUtils

Skip menu "KUtils"
  • Main Page
  • Namespace List
  • Namespace Members
  • Alphabetical List
  • Class List
  • Class Hierarchy
  • Class Members
  • File List
  • File Members
  • Related Pages

kdelibs API Reference

Skip menu "kdelibs API Reference"
  • DNSSD
  • Interfaces
  •   KHexEdit
  •   KMediaPlayer
  •   KSpeech
  •   KTextEditor
  • kconf_update
  • KDE3Support
  •   KUnitTest
  • KDECore
  • KDED
  • KDEsu
  • KDEUI
  • KDEWebKit
  • KDocTools
  • KFile
  • KHTML
  • KImgIO
  • KInit
  • kio
  • KIOSlave
  • KJS
  •   KJS-API
  • kjsembed
  •   WTF
  • KNewStuff
  • KParts
  • KPty
  • Kross
  • KUnitConversion
  • KUtils
  • Nepomuk
  • Nepomuk-Core
  • Nepomuk
  • Plasma
  • Solid
  • Sonnet
  • ThreadWeaver

Search



Report problems with this website to our bug tracking system.
Contact the specific authors with questions and comments about the page contents.

KDE® and the K Desktop Environment® logo are registered trademarks of KDE e.V. | Legal